What is American Bridge Company's CSA score?

FMCSA does not publish a single CSA score for carriers. American Bridge Company's public safety data includes its roadside inspection out-of-service rates and crash record, listed on this page.

What is American Bridge Company's FMCSA safety rating?

American Bridge Company has no published FMCSA safety rating. Most US carriers have never received a rating review, so an unrated carrier is the common case, not a warning sign by itself.
